Question:
Parent S requires three of component T and two of component U. Both T and U are run on work center 30. Setup time for T is 7 hours, and run time is 0.1 hour per piece. For component U, setup time is 8 hours, and run time is 0.2 hour per piece. If the rated capacity of the work center is 120 hours, how many Ts and Us should be produced in a week?
